HB 1547: Conditional Geriatric Release

GENERAL BILL by Chambliss

Conditional Geriatric Release ; Requires Florida Commission on Offender Review, in conjunction with DOC, to establish conditional geriatric release program; specifies eligibility for program; authorizes persons sentenced to custody of department to apply to commission to be considered for conditional geriatric release within specified time before reaching eligibility; specifies that person does not have right to conditional geriatric release; requires commission to consider any evidence relevant to public safety; authorizes commission to consider continued cost to department to house inmate; specifies that commission has sole discretion to determine whether to grant conditional geriatric release; authorizes revocation of conditional geriatric release for violations of any conditions of release; requires rulemaking.

Effective Date: 7/1/2026
Last Action: 1/9/2026 House - Filed
